Types of Backpacking Espresso Makers

Several types of portable espresso makers cater to backpackers. Manual lever machines like the AeroPress Go are lightweight and produce excellent coffee. Stovetop espresso makers (Moka pots) are durable and offer a classic espresso experience but require a heat source. Battery-powered electric espresso machines offer convenience and self-heating capabilities but can be heavier. Capsule-compatible machines offer convenience but limit your coffee choices. Consider the trade-offs of each type to determine which aligns best with your backpacking style. Choosing the best backpacking espresso maker comes down to personal preference and needs.

How important is the pressure rating (bar) for a backpacking espresso maker?

A higher bar pressure generally results in a richer crema and a more intense espresso flavor. Most espresso machines aim for around 9 bars of pressure. Many portable electric models boast 20 bars. While a higher pressure is desirable, it’s not the only factor determining coffee quality. Other factors, such as the quality of the coffee and the brewing process, also play a significant role. For backpacking, consider the trade-off between pressure and portability. The best backpacking espresso maker will balance these qualities.

How do I clean a backpacking espresso maker in the wilderness?

Ease of cleaning is crucial. Look for models with simple designs and easily detachable parts. Rinse the components with water after each use to prevent coffee buildup. For a deeper clean, use biodegradable soap and a small brush. Be sure to pack out all waste, including coffee grounds. Dispose of wastewater responsibly, following Leave No Trace principles. Some models are dishwasher-safe, but this isn’t practical in the backcountry. The best backpacking espresso maker is easy to clean.

Can I use pre-ground coffee with all backpacking espresso makers?

Most manual and stovetop espresso makers can use pre-ground coffee. However, the grind size is crucial for optimal extraction. Use a fine grind specifically designed for espresso. Electric espresso makers that accept ground coffee typically require a specific grind size as well. Capsule-compatible machines require pre-packaged capsules. Consider your preferred coffee type and the grind size requirements of the espresso maker. The best backpacking espresso maker should suit your coffee preferences.
